Here are the top stories today in Marietta:
- The Boys and Girls Club of Washington County is clearing the way for a new teen center. They plan to name it after Garrett Scott, a former Boys and Girls Club counselor who tragically passed away. (WTAP)
- Memorial Health System donated $54,000 to help the hungry in Southeast Ohio. (WTAP)
- An explosion at a Parkersburg recycling plant has been ruled an accident. (WTAP)
- A guilty plea in Athens County ends the horrible saga of the Bellar family sexual abuse case. (WOUB)
